Role:
On behalf of the client, we are seeking an experienced individual as Project Manager / Senior Project Manager Building Construction to manage complex construction projects within professional project management. You will oversee demanding projects through all relevant project phases and, depending on the mandate, take on tasks in client representation, client trusteeship, overall project management, or general planner coordination. A particular focus is on existing buildings and projects under ongoing operation, where costs, schedules, quality, and risks must be consistently managed. You will lead interdisciplinary project teams and combine classic construction project management with BIM, digitalisation, contract management, and professional project controlling.
Responsibilities:
Leading and managing demanding building construction projects in project management / construction management through all relevant project phases
Taking on mandates in client representation, client trusteeship, overall project management, or general planner coordination
Managing complex renovation, refurbishment, and existing building projects under ongoing operation
Responsibility for cost, schedule, quality, and risk management including forecasts, target-actual comparisons, and control measures
Leading and coordinating architects, specialist planners, experts, site managers, and other project participants
Establishing and maintaining project organisation, milestone planning, decision-making processes, and reporting structures
Conducting structured project controlling and reporting to clients and other decision-making bodies
Coordinating planning, tendering, awarding, and implementation processes and monitoring relevant interfaces
Participating in contract, change, and claim management as well as reviewing cost and schedule impacts
Applying and further developing BIM and digital project management processes for planning, coordination, and documentation
Using MS Project, Provis, Messerli or comparable systems for schedule, cost, and project control
Ensuring transparent project administration, invoice verification, and project documentation in compliance with relevant SIA standards
